Retry Logic In TestNG || How to execute failed test cases in Selenium WebDriver
How to execute failed test cases in Selenium WebDriver using IRetryAnalyzer in TestNG.
I'm sure, you are facing random failure during an automated test run. These failures might not necessarily be because of product bugs.
These failure can be because of following reasons:
+Random browser issues
+Browser becoming unresponsive
+Random machine issues
+Server issues like unexpected delay in the response from server
+Application not responding properly
+Application is very slow
+Network is very slow, hence app is very slow
+Ajax Component could not be loaded properly
+HTML DOM is slow
There are two ways to implement retry logic using TestNG Listener:
1. By specifying retryAnalyzer value in the @Test annotation
2. By adding Retry analyser during run time by implementing IAnnotationTransformer interfaces
======================================================
Subscribe to this channel, and press bell icon to get some interesting videos on Selenium and Automation:
https://www.youtube.com/c/Naveen%20AutomationLabs?sub_confirmation=1
Follow me on my Facebook Page:
https://www.facebook.com/groups/naveenqtpexpert/
Let's join our Automation community for some amazing knowledge sharing and group discussion:
https://t.me/joinchat/COJqZQ4enmEt4JACKLNLUg Subscribe to this channel, and press bell icon to get some interesting videos on Selenium and Automation:
https://www.youtube.com/c/Naveen%20AutomationLabs?sub_confirmation=1
Follow me on my Facebook Page:
https://www.facebook.com/groups/naveenqtpexpert/
Let's join our Automation community for some amazing knowledge sharing and group discussion on Telegram:
https://t.me/joinchat/COJqZUPB02r5sB73YMdXEw
Paid courses (Recorded) videos:
Java & Selenium Course: http://www.naveenautomationlabs.com/p/course-content-selenium-webdriver-is.html
API Course: http://www.naveenautomationlabs.com/p/syllabus-course-content-manual-testing.html ➡️Get Our Courses✔️
📗 Get My Paid Courses at
Paid courses (Recorded) videos:
Java & Selenium Course: http://www.naveenautomationlabs.com/p/course-content-selenium-webdriver-is.html
API Course: http://www.naveenautomationlabs.com/p/syllabus-course-content-manual-testing.html
-------------------------------
✔️SOCIAL NETWORKS
Facebook: https://www.facebook.com/groups/naveenqtpexpert/
Twitter: https://twitter.com/naveenkhunteta
Blog: http://www.naveenautomationlabs.com
--------------------------------
Support My Channel✔️Or Buy Me A Coffee
Paypal: https://paypal.me/naveenkhunteta
Google Pay: naveenanimation20@gmail.com
--------------------------------
✔️Thanks for watching!
देखने के लिए धन्यवाद
Благодаря за гледането
感谢您观看
Merci d'avoir regardé
Grazie per la visione
Gracias por ver
شكرا للمشاهدة
Видео Retry Logic In TestNG || How to execute failed test cases in Selenium WebDriver канала Naveen AutomationLabs
I'm sure, you are facing random failure during an automated test run. These failures might not necessarily be because of product bugs.
These failure can be because of following reasons:
+Random browser issues
+Browser becoming unresponsive
+Random machine issues
+Server issues like unexpected delay in the response from server
+Application not responding properly
+Application is very slow
+Network is very slow, hence app is very slow
+Ajax Component could not be loaded properly
+HTML DOM is slow
There are two ways to implement retry logic using TestNG Listener:
1. By specifying retryAnalyzer value in the @Test annotation
2. By adding Retry analyser during run time by implementing IAnnotationTransformer interfaces
======================================================
Subscribe to this channel, and press bell icon to get some interesting videos on Selenium and Automation:
https://www.youtube.com/c/Naveen%20AutomationLabs?sub_confirmation=1
Follow me on my Facebook Page:
https://www.facebook.com/groups/naveenqtpexpert/
Let's join our Automation community for some amazing knowledge sharing and group discussion:
https://t.me/joinchat/COJqZQ4enmEt4JACKLNLUg Subscribe to this channel, and press bell icon to get some interesting videos on Selenium and Automation:
https://www.youtube.com/c/Naveen%20AutomationLabs?sub_confirmation=1
Follow me on my Facebook Page:
https://www.facebook.com/groups/naveenqtpexpert/
Let's join our Automation community for some amazing knowledge sharing and group discussion on Telegram:
https://t.me/joinchat/COJqZUPB02r5sB73YMdXEw
Paid courses (Recorded) videos:
Java & Selenium Course: http://www.naveenautomationlabs.com/p/course-content-selenium-webdriver-is.html
API Course: http://www.naveenautomationlabs.com/p/syllabus-course-content-manual-testing.html ➡️Get Our Courses✔️
📗 Get My Paid Courses at
Paid courses (Recorded) videos:
Java & Selenium Course: http://www.naveenautomationlabs.com/p/course-content-selenium-webdriver-is.html
API Course: http://www.naveenautomationlabs.com/p/syllabus-course-content-manual-testing.html
-------------------------------
✔️SOCIAL NETWORKS
Facebook: https://www.facebook.com/groups/naveenqtpexpert/
Twitter: https://twitter.com/naveenkhunteta
Blog: http://www.naveenautomationlabs.com
--------------------------------
Support My Channel✔️Or Buy Me A Coffee
Paypal: https://paypal.me/naveenkhunteta
Google Pay: naveenanimation20@gmail.com
--------------------------------
✔️Thanks for watching!
देखने के लिए धन्यवाद
Благодаря за гледането
感谢您观看
Merci d'avoir regardé
Grazie per la visione
Gracias por ver
شكرا للمشاهدة
Видео Retry Logic In TestNG || How to execute failed test cases in Selenium WebDriver канала Naveen AutomationLabs
Показать
Комментарии отсутствуют
Информация о видео
Другие видео канала
![Soft Assertion in TestNG in Selenium Webdriver || Soft Assert vs Hard Assert in TestNG](https://i.ytimg.com/vi/IQiZgpXRZIQ/default.jpg)
![Selenium Framework for Beginners 27 | TestNG How to Rerun (Retry) Failed tests | Selenium Framework](https://i.ytimg.com/vi/9eUKJ5Nb7ag/default.jpg)
![Different Types of Manual Testing || Functional & Non Functional Testing](https://i.ytimg.com/vi/c7sTobUw32U/default.jpg)
![All OOP Concepts in POM-Use of Abstract Class,Inheritance,Overloading,Overriding,Encapsulation](https://i.ytimg.com/vi/g3r5KK2Acx8/default.jpg)
![](https://i.ytimg.com/vi/w-slskj7kTA/default.jpg)
![Remove White Spaces in a String in Java](https://i.ytimg.com/vi/H9yx5x8lDB8/default.jpg)
![How to execute failed test cases in Selenium webdriver](https://i.ytimg.com/vi/kaUJgNyLaKs/default.jpg)
![How to Read Excel File in Selenium Webdriver Using Apache POI](https://i.ytimg.com/vi/sbBdj4zIMqY/default.jpg)
![What is Agile || Agile Testing Interview Questions and Answers](https://i.ytimg.com/vi/lA0kRFNKmu4/default.jpg)
![PART 8 - Rerun Failure #SCENARIOS in Cucumber BDD](https://i.ytimg.com/vi/3BBxrDblEWc/default.jpg)
![How to take screenshot of failed test cases in Selenium Webdriver](https://i.ytimg.com/vi/1kYn44-5Fy4/default.jpg)
![Taking ScreenShot ONLY for Failed Tests in Selenium using TestNG Listener](https://i.ytimg.com/vi/1V1w8ccRp_M/default.jpg)
![Method Overriding, Inheritance and Polymorphism in Java - Core Java - Part -13](https://i.ytimg.com/vi/DWpYniQAVyI/default.jpg)
![How to Generate Log Files in Selenium using Log4j API](https://i.ytimg.com/vi/C7TEuhgVDYo/default.jpg)
![TestNG How to do Parallel Testing | Selenium Parallel testing TestNG | Step by Step for Beginners](https://i.ytimg.com/vi/1Y6knVutUsI/default.jpg)
![TestNG Interview Questions and Answers || TestNG Framework Interview Questions](https://i.ytimg.com/vi/_RwrCqh0hBk/default.jpg)
![How to find broken links & Images using Selenium Webdriver](https://i.ytimg.com/vi/f_8yUC52g34/default.jpg)
![Difference between Interface and Absract Class](https://i.ytimg.com/vi/4oEV1aYcOwI/default.jpg)
![How to Implement TestNG listeners in Selenium Webdriver](https://i.ytimg.com/vi/-a5aHd0gsGw/default.jpg)
![Selenium Framework for Beginners 13 | Selenium What is testng.xml | How to create testng.xml](https://i.ytimg.com/vi/gBpLmQgkqsw/default.jpg)